This is my second time applying for a UK student visa. I applied with the standard processing and did not choose the priority service. I got my visa approved in 5 business days and it was shipped the same day that I got the e-mail that it was despatched from the visa center! I feel like I lucked out for sure. Here's my timeline.

10/8: Online application submitted
10/26: Biometrics appointment. This was the earliest appointment I could get but was in and out within 10 minutes. I shipped off the documents the same day with one day air shipping through UPS. With the return label included, it cost $100 in total. YIKES. You can definitely save if you go with 2 day shipping instead though.
10/27: Application delivered to mail room. The only way I knew was because I checked the UPS tracking. I received no communication from the consulate
11/2: received e-mail from VFS that my visa application was processed and would be despatched to the address on my return shipping label. I checked UPS and it was sent off that evening.
11/3: received my passport with the visa attached!

So relieved that I got my visa within 5 business days without paying premium prices! Kind of weird how they don't send any updates at all though until it's shipped out.

READ THIS BEFORE YOU SEND IN YOUR DOCUMENTS.

Getting this Visa was a nightmare. However, that was only partly due to the British Consulate. I know you see a lot of bad reviews here, but don't be scared. I think those are people who didn't do their research. Be careful and you should be fine. Read my tips below for a (hopefully) easier experience!

Timeline:
9/18/2017 - Documents sent via UPS Overnight to Consulate
9/19/2017 - Documents confirmed received
9/19/2017 - (SAME DAY) Visa approved
9/21/2017 - Documents returned

- Do your research. Do not take the UK Government's website for everything you might need, they don't list everything they should, as stated by my examples below.

- MAIL DOCUMENTS VIA UPS, FEDEX OR VFS GLOBAL. DO NOT USE ANYTHING ELSE UNLESS YOU'RE SURE IT'LL WORK. They don't accept USPS, which is what I had originally sent my documents in. I only found out that they don't accept USPS through research; they had answered a question about it on Twitter. That should be standard information on their website, but it's not.

- Make sure you have all the correct documentation - DO YOUR RESEARCH ON THIS. IT IS CRUCIAL. I didn't know I needed to send two passport photos with my application, as that was not on the government website. Look around the internet, make sure you have everything. What you might need: application, proof of funds, passport size photos (can be taken at a pharmacy or UPS/packaging store), acceptance/placement letters, and biometrics.

- Label everything. Make it easier for them and they'll make it easier for you. I saw another reviewer do this, and I decided to do it too. I labeled every section with sticky notes on the side, so that all the information would be easy to find. I don't know if it actually helps, but I sincerely doubt it could hurt.

- Unless you have a weird/special circumstance, do not try to call or email them. It will just cost you money, it won't help. They promptly email you when things are received or sent.

Hopefully, your experience is as easy as mine was. Good luck!
